How to Make a Bed Frame from Wood Pallets

Creating a bed frame from wood pallets is a rewarding DIY project that can save you money and add a unique touch to your bedroom. Pallets are readily available, often free or inexpensive, and their rustic charm can complement various design styles. This guide will walk you through the process of transforming pallets into a sturdy and stylish bed frame.

1. Gather Your Materials and Tools

Before you begin, ensure you have the necessary materials and tools:

  • Wood pallets: Choose pallets in good condition, free from rot, pests, or damage. Consider using 4x4 pallets for sturdiness, but you could use smaller pallets for a lower frame.
  • Wood screws: Select screws that are long enough to securely fasten the pallet pieces together.
  • Wood glue: Using glue in addition to screws will enhance the strength and stability of your bed frame.
  • Measuring tape: Essential for accurate measurements of the pallet pieces.
  • Level: Use a level to ensure your bed frame is straight and stable.
  • Circular saw or handsaw: For cutting pallet pieces to size, if necessary.
  • Drill: For pre-drilling holes for screws, preventing wood splitting.
  • Safety glasses: Protect your eyes while working with power tools and wood scraps.
  • Sandpaper: Smooth any rough edges or splinters on the pallets.
  • Paint or stain: Optional, for customizing the look of your bed frame.
  • Mattress: Choose a mattress that fits the dimensions of your bed frame.

2. Prepare the Pallets

Once you have gathered your materials, prepare the pallets for bed frame construction. This step involves cleaning, inspecting, and potentially modifying the pallets.

  1. Clean the Pallets: Remove any dirt, debris, or loose staples with a brush or vacuum cleaner. For stubborn stains, use a mild soap and water solution.
  2. Inspect for Damage: Carefully examine each pallet for signs of rot, pests, or structural weaknesses. Repair any damage by replacing or reinforcing damaged wood.
  3. Disassemble if Necessary: If the pallets are too large or require modification, dismantle them using a pry bar or hammer. Remove any nails or staples that are not securely fastened.
  4. Sanitize: To ensure the surfaces are safe and clean, you can apply a wood cleaner or mild bleach solution to the pallets. Allow the pallets to dry completely before proceeding.
  5. Sanding: Smooth any rough edges or splinters on the pallet pieces using sandpaper. This will improve the overall look and feel of your bed frame.

3. Constructing the Bed Frame

With your prepped pallets ready, you can start constructing the bed frame. This process involves arranging the pallets and securing them together to form a solid structure.

  1. Layout: Determine the size and shape of your desired bed frame. You may want to sketch out a simple plan on paper. Arrange the pallets in the desired configuration to create the bed frame. You can use two pallets for a single bed, four for a queen-size, and so on.
  2. Attaching the Pallets: Secure the pallets together using wood screws and wood glue. Pre-drill holes for screws in the pallets to prevent splitting. Create a stable base and headboard by connecting the pallets horizontally and vertically using screws and glue.
  3. Reinforcements: For additional strength and stability, consider adding cross-braces or support beams to the underside of the frame. Secure these reinforcements with screws and glue as well.
  4. Leveling: Use a level to ensure that the bed frame is straight and stable before moving on to the final steps.

4. Finishing Touches

Once the bed frame is assembled, add the final touches to complete the project. This includes painting or staining the frame, adding a headboard and footboard, and incorporating decorative elements.

  1. Painting or Staining: You can enhance the look of your bed frame by painting or staining it. Choose a color or finish that complements your bedroom décor. Apply the paint or stain in thin coats, allowing each coat to dry completely before applying the next.
  2. Headboard and Footboard: Consider adding a headboard and footboard for extra comfort and style. You can create a custom headboard and footboard from pallets, or use pre-made options from a furniture store.
  3. Decorative Elements: If desired, add decorative elements or personalized touches to your bed frame. You could add wood carvings, metal accents, or fabric embellishments for a unique look.

By following these steps, you can create a stylish and functional bed frame from wood pallets that will enhance your bedroom decor and save you money. Remember to prioritize safety when working with power tools and always wear appropriate safety gear.
